Ralph J. Smialowicz is a scholar working on Immunology,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is and Cancer Research. According to data from OpenAlex, Ralph J. Smialowicz has authored 80 papers receiving a total of 2.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 41 papers in Immunology, 28 papers in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is and 17 papers in Cancer Research. Recurrent topics in Ralph J. Smialowicz's work include Immunotoxicology and immune responses (30 papers), Effects and risks of endocrine disrupting chemicals (17 papers) and Carcinogens and Genotoxicity Assessment (17 papers). Ralph J. Smialowicz is often cited by papers focused on Immunotoxicology and immune responses (30 papers), Effects and risks of endocrine disrupting chemicals (17 papers) and Carcinogens and Genotoxicity Assessment (17 papers). Ralph J. Smialowicz collaborates with scholars based in United States, Netherlands and India. Ralph J. Smialowicz's co-authors include Steven D. Holladay, Marie M. Riddle, Ronald R. Rogers, Robert W. Luebke, Bradley Gehrs, Wanda C. Williams, John H. Schwab, Ruth A. Etzel, Rodney R. Dietert and Kenneth S. Landreth and has published in prestigious journals such as Environmental Health Perspectives, Infection and Immunity and Environmental Research.
